2. Liquid flow out of a spherical tank discharging through a valve can be described approximately by the following nonlinear differential equation: dtdh=(Dh)h1(qiCvh) where h is the liquid level, D is the diameter of the tank, qi is the volumetric flow rate of liquid into the tank, and Cv is a constant. (a) Derive a linearized model (in deviation variables). (15%) (b) Develop a transfer function relating the liquid level to the volumetric flow rate of liquid into the tank. Give the final expression in terms of the standard form of the first-order transfer function. (10\%)
